There were 91 entries in the $40,000 AltaGas Cup 1.45m,making for a top jump-off of 11 horse and rider combinations.The early leader was Daniel Bluman (COL) on Believe, owned by Blue Star Investments. They set the time at 36.72 seconds, which held up for third place. Four horses later, the time was dropped to 35.30 seconds by Eric Lamaze on Artisan Farms LLC's Fine Lady 5, which looked good for the win but wasn't quite enough when the last horse entered the ring.

Sitting in the final position in the jump-off, Kenny knew what he had to do for victory. "I knew Eric had to be very fast," Kenny acknowledged. "He's a very careful horse, and I just said 'Ok, jump one, as tight as I can back to two, go to three, and then just relax to the double (combination), and then just go as fast as I could." The plan worked when Kenny and Prof de la Roque, an 11-year-old Selle Francais gelding by Kannan x Damiro, were efficient through the first five jumps on course and positively blistering through the final three jumps. They brought the winning time down to 34.42 seconds.

The victory and good ride for Prof de la Roque was a confidence builder for the horse, who slipped in a turn last week in the International Ring. "He came back this week, and he was a little bit worried about that. He was a little fresh, so he was a little bit tense the first day, and it didn't go exactly to plan. Today he was amazing. He's funny. Sometimes he's so cocky and then sometimes, (he says) 'Oh, you have to be there for me.'"

Kenny felt that the smaller Meadows on the Green ring suited Prof de la Roque. "The jumps come up a lot faster in here, and it's very careful jumping in this ring. In the big (International) Ring, the jumps hold them off a little bit," he noted. "In this ring, they don't all. It's a little bit more difficult in that, I find anyway. That's why it suits him. My plan was always to try and do well in one of these classes this week."

Kenny said that he doesn't ride Prof de la Roque "all that much" when they're not getting ready for the competition ring. "Delphine who works for us rides him a good bit. He's kind of a high, energetic horse. She gets on really well with him and keeps him really relaxed. I ride him every so often," he explained.

While he is still deciding Prof de la Roque's schedule for the rest of the week, Kenny does know that he will lean on this horse more in the final three weeks of the Spruce Meadows Summer Series when some of his other horses travel to Europe. "He's a great horse to have like that. I'm very lucky to have so many nice horses and so many people to own those great horses," he said.
